深度揭秘《传2》源码:探寻背后技术奥秘的旅程
在科技飞速发展的今天,游戏产业作为文化娱乐的重要组成部分,吸引了无数开发者和玩家的目光。其中,《传2》作为一款备受瞩目的游戏,其源码的神秘面纱一直备受关注。本文将带领读者深入剖析《传2》源码,探寻其背后的技术奥秘。
一、《传2》简介
《传2》是由我国知名游戏开发团队制作的MMORPG游戏,继承了前作《传世》的经典元素,在画面、玩法、世界观等方面进行了全面升级。自上线以来,凭借其独特的游戏体验和丰富的内容,吸引了大量玩家。而在这背后,则是《传2》源码的强大支持。
二、源码解析
1.游戏引擎
《传2》采用了Unity3D引擎进行开发,Unity3D是一款功能强大的游戏开发平台,具有跨平台、易用性高等特点。在《传2》中,Unity3D引擎为游戏提供了稳定的运行环境,同时降低了开发成本。
2.游戏架构
《传2》采用了模块化设计,将游戏分为多个模块,如角色系统、任务系统、社交系统等。这种设计使得游戏易于维护和扩展,同时也提高了开发效率。
3.网络通信
《传2》采用了客户端-服务器架构,通过网络通信实现玩家之间的交互和数据同步。在源码中,我们可以看到网络通信模块采用了TCP/IP协议,保证了数据传输的稳定性和安全性。
4.图形渲染
《传2》的图形渲染采用了Unity3D引擎自带的Shader和Material系统,通过顶点着色器和片元着色器实现高质量的视觉效果。在源码中,我们可以看到游戏中的角色、场景等元素的渲染过程。
5.音效处理
《传2》的音效处理采用了Unity3D引擎自带的AudioMixer系统,实现了音效的混音、淡入淡出等功能。在源码中,我们可以看到游戏中的音效播放、音量控制等模块。
6.数据存储
《传2》采用MySQL数据库进行数据存储,通过SQL语句实现数据的增删改查。在源码中,我们可以看到游戏中的角色信息、装备信息等数据的存储和查询过程。
三、技术亮点
1.高度优化的游戏性能
《传2》源码在性能优化方面下了很大功夫,通过多线程、异步加载等技术,实现了游戏的流畅运行。
2.强大的社交系统
《传2》的社交系统功能丰富,包括好友、组队、公会等,满足了玩家之间的互动需求。
3.独特的成长体系
《传2》采用了独特的成长体系,玩家可以通过完成任务、参与活动等方式提升自己的实力,增加了游戏的趣味性和挑战性。
四、总结
通过对《传2》源码的解析,我们可以看到这款游戏在技术方面的卓越表现。从游戏引擎的选择,到游戏架构、网络通信、图形渲染等方面的设计,都体现了开发团队的用心和实力。相信在未来的发展中,《传2》会继续为我们带来更多精彩的游戏体验。
总之,《传2》源码的揭秘之旅,让我们对游戏开发有了更深入的了解。在今后的游戏开发过程中,我们也可以借鉴《传2》的技术优势,为玩家带来更多优质的娱乐产品。